Understanding RTX 5090 Laptop Performance

RTX 5090 gaming laptops represent the pinnacle of portable gaming performance, featuring NVIDIA’s most powerful mobile graphics processor. With 10,496 CUDA cores and 24GB of GDDR7 memory, these GPUs deliver performance that rivals many desktop systems.

The key innovation is DLSS 4 technology with Multi-Frame Generation. This AI-powered feature can generate multiple intermediate frames, dramatically boosting frame rates while maintaining image quality. In our testing, Cyberpunk 2077 with path tracing went from 45 FPS to over 120 FPS with DLSS 4 enabled.

Power consumption is significant, with most RTX 5090 laptops drawing 300-400W under load. This requires robust cooling solutions, which is why most models feature multiple fans and heat pipes. Battery life is typically limited to 1-2 hours during gaming.

Desktop vs mobile RTX 5090 performance is closer than ever. While the mobile version has slightly lower clock speeds, the difference is often less than 15% in real-world gaming. This makes RTX 5090 laptops viable desktop replacements for many users.

DLSS 4: NVIDIA’s Deep Learning Super Sampling 4 uses AI to upscale lower resolution images to higher resolutions while generating multiple intermediate frames for smoother gameplay.

How to Choose the Right RTX 5090 Laptop?

Choosing the perfect RTX 5090 laptop requires balancing several factors. With prices ranging from $3,269 to $3,999, understanding what matters most for your use case is crucial.

For Maximum Portability: Look for Weight Under 6 Pounds

The MSI Stealth A16 AI+ at 4.63 pounds demonstrates that you don’t have to sacrifice portability for performance. These ultra-portable models use advanced cooling solutions to manage heat in smaller chassis. Expect trade-offs in port selection and potentially higher temperatures under sustained load.

For the Best Display: Choose Between OLED and Mini-LED

OLED panels like those on the Lenovo Legion Pro 7i offer perfect blacks and vibrant colors but may have lower peak brightness. Mini-LED displays like the ASUS ROG Nebula HDR provide higher brightness and better HDR performance without burn-in risk. For content creators, OLED’s color accuracy is hard to beat.

For Professional Work: Prioritize Memory and Storage

Models with 64GB RAM like the MSI Stealth A16 AI+ and Lenovo Legion Pro 7i (64GB) handle professional workloads better. Multiple SSDs in RAID 0 configuration, as seen in the Legion Pro, provide faster storage performance. Windows 11 Pro adds business features some users need.

For Cooling Performance: Check Fan Design and Heat Pipes

The Thunderobot Zero 18 Pro’s three-fan system with seven heat pipes shows how important cooling is for sustained performance. Look for models with vapor chamber cooling and liquid metal application on the CPU for the best thermal performance.

For Future-Proofing: Consider Connectivity

Wi-Fi 7 is becoming standard on high-end models, providing faster wireless speeds and lower latency. Thunderbolt 5, while not yet available on these models, is something to watch for in future releases. Multiple USB-C ports with Power Delivery support provide more flexibility.

✅ Pro Tip: Consider your primary use case. For pure gaming, prioritize display refresh rate and cooling. For professional work, focus on RAM and storage. For portability, weight and battery life matter most.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is the Nvidia RTX 5090 good for gaming?

Yes, the RTX 5090 is exceptional for gaming. It delivers desktop-class performance in a laptop form factor, capable of running all modern games at 4K resolution with high frame rates and ray tracing enabled.

Which laptops have the RTX 5090?

Major brands offering RTX 5090 laptops include MSI Stealth A16 AI+, Lenovo Legion Pro 7i, HP OMEN MAX 16, Thunderobot Zero 18 Pro, Dell Alienware 18, and ASUS ROG Strix SCAR 16. Prices range from $3,269 to $3,999.

What’s the best RTX for gaming laptops?

The RTX 5090 is the best mobile GPU available. It delivers 45-55% better performance than the RTX 5080 and is ideal for 4K gaming. The RTX 4080 remains a strong value option for 1440p gaming at lower prices.

Is 5090 overkill for gaming?

For 1080p or 1440p gaming, the RTX 5090 is overkill. However, for 4K gaming with ray tracing, AI workloads, and future-proofing, it’s justified. Professional users working with video rendering or 3D modeling will benefit from its power.

Is 5090 enough for 4K gaming?

Yes, the RTX 5090 handles 4K gaming exceptionally well. With DLSS 4 enabled, most games maintain 60+ FPS at 4K resolution with maximum settings. Games like Cyberpunk 2077 and Alan Wake 2 run smoothly with path tracing enabled.

How much does an RTX 5090 laptop cost?

RTX 5090 laptops range from $3,269 for models like the Lenovo Legion Pro 7i to $3,999 for premium options like the MSI Stealth A16 AI+. The price varies based on configuration, brand, and additional features.

What’s the battery life on RTX 5090 laptops?

Battery life is typically 1-2 hours during gaming due to high power consumption. For general use, expect 4-6 hours depending on the model and usage patterns. The lightest models tend to have better battery efficiency.

Do RTX 5090 laptops overheat?

Modern RTX 5090 laptops have advanced cooling systems to prevent overheating. While they run warm under load, quality models maintain safe operating temperatures. Models with better cooling like the Thunderobot Zero 18 Pro perform best under sustained loads.
